Influence of Discovery Learning Supported by Solar System Scope Application on Students’ Curiosity: The Case of Teaching Solar System

Abstract: Education in the Industrial Revolution 4.0 requires students to understand how they can use technology and connect knowledge with the real world. This study aimed to investigate the influence of implementing discovery learning supported by the Solar System Scope application on students' curiosity. The method used is a weak experiment. The one group pre-test post-test is used in this research as a research design. Participants were 31 7 th grade students at one Junior High School in Bandung, Indonesia. The resu… Show more
